1. Healthcare Digital ICs:

Medical Digital Integrated Circuits (ICs) are specialized semiconductor devices designed to meet the stringent needs of clinical purposes. These ICs are engineered to provide superior performance, precision, and dependability, generating them ideal for use in significant medical products for example affected person displays, defibrillators, infusion pumps, and health care imaging devices.

Inside the medical industry, precision and regularity are paramount, and Clinical Electronic ICs are personalized to provide precise analog and electronic sign processing, sensor interfacing, ability administration, and conversation abilities. They undergo demanding screening and certification processes to be certain compliance with market standards and restrictions, for example ISO 13485 and IEC 60601, governing the protection and usefulness of medical units.

2. Microcontrollers:

Microcontrollers are compact built-in circuits that include a central processing device (CPU), memory, enter/output ports, along with other peripherals into a single chip. In health care electronics, microcontrollers function the "brains" of assorted units, furnishing the computational electrical power and Regulate necessary for machine operation and features.

Professional medical units normally need true-time data processing, sensor integration, user interface control, and interaction abilities, all of which can be efficiently managed by microcontrollers. Whether or not It can be checking vital indicators, administering therapy, or handling machine parameters, microcontrollers help precise Management and automation, boosting the functionality and usefulness of healthcare units.

3. Monolithic ICs:

Monolithic Integrated Circuits (ICs) are semiconductor products fabricated on one silicon wafer, where all components, such as transistors, resistors, capacitors, and interconnections, are integrated into a single chip. In the health-related area, monolithic ICs Monolithic Ic discover programs in an array of health-related units, which include implantable professional medical equipment, diagnostic equipment, and wearable wellbeing displays.

The compact dimensions, minimal energy consumption, and significant trustworthiness of monolithic ICs make them properly-suited to health care programs where House, electricity effectiveness, and durability are critical factors. Whether or not It is really coming up with miniaturized implantable devices or transportable diagnostic tools, monolithic ICs permit the development of Innovative professional medical remedies that improve client outcomes and quality of life.
